Think of puppy daycare as socialization school. It’s where your furry friend learns to communicate with other dogs in a safe, supervised setting. This is crucial for preventing the fear or reactivity that can develop in puppies who only know the solitude of a farm or a quiet home. A good daycare introduces them to various playstyles, teaching bite inhibition and proper play manners. For our local owners, here’s actionable advice: Don’t just choose any daycare. Look for one that offers a **separate, dedicated space for puppies**. Their immune systems and social needs are different from adult dogs. Ask about their vaccination requirements (a must!), their staff-to-puppy ratio, and how they handle naptime (puppies need lots of sleep!). A great facility will have a structured schedule mixing play, rest, and basic training reinforcement.

Before you commit, schedule a visit and a trial day. Watch how the staff interacts with the puppies—are they engaged and compassionate? Your puppy should come home happily tired, not overly stressed. Use daycare as a tool, not an everyday solution; 2-3 days a week is often perfect for balancing socialization with bonding time at home.
